October 5, (THEWILL) – Trent Alexander-Arnold scored the best goal of the fixture as Liverpool defeated Rangers 2-0 to earn back-to-back UEFA Champions League victories.
Despite being somewhat behind the curve this season, Jurgen Klopp’s team quickly took the lead at Anfield courtesy of a superb Alexander-Arnold free kick that beat Allan McGregor squarely.
Following the break, Mohamed Salah added a second goal with a penalty, and the lacklustre Rangers were grateful that McGregor prevented Liverpool from doing more damage by widening the score margin with more goals.
The Tuesday loss means the Scottish team has now given up nine goals in three group stage games but the Reds remained three points behind Group A leaders Napoli, who thrashed Ajax 6-1 in Tuesday’s other match of the group. Rangers are precariously stuck at the bottom of the standings after yet another disappointing performance in Europe.
On Saturday, Rangers will host St. Mirren back in some Scottish Premiership action. In the EPL, Liverpool will be away at the north London grounds of leaders Arsenal to attempt once more to get their season back on track.
